In this review of Rainbow Light Multivitamin for Women the bottom line is clear: this formula is aimed at women seeking a food-based, vegetarian multivitamin that supports daily energy and overall female health. The supplement blends research-backed vitamins with organic fruits, vegetables and traditional herbs to provide an all-in-one daily capsule. For those who prioritize plant-derived ingredients and a capsule that is generally easy to swallow, this multivitamin delivers a straightforward way to add balanced nutrients and supportive botanicals to a routine.
Key Features
- Food-based nutrition: Combines vitamins and minerals with organic whole foods like spirulina, acai and kale to provide nutrients from recognizable plant sources.
- Targeted female support: Includes DIM, organic dong quai and organic rhodiola to support hormonal balance and resilience specific to womens health.
- Energy and vitality: Formulated to help renew and strengthen core body systems for sustained energy and mental focus throughout the day.
- Vegetarian capsules: Easy-to-swallow vegetable capsules that avoid animal gelatin for those following a vegetarian or plant-forward lifestyle.
- Non-GMO ingredients: The product is presented as non-GMO and uses organic extracts, appealing to shoppers who prefer cleaner ingredient lists.
Who It's For
This multivitamin is best for adult women who want a comprehensive, food-based daily supplement that includes botanicals traditionally used for female health. It works well for those who value organic plant extracts like beet, pomegranate and green tea alongside standard vitamins and who prefer a single, easy capsule each day.
Women seeking extremely high isolated nutrient doses, or individuals who react strongly to herbal extracts, may want to compare ingredient amounts or consult a clinician before switching. Those with persistent nausea from supplements should test tolerance carefully, as a small number of customers reported stomach upset.
